//! Intent-based workflow for agentic development
//!
//! Intents replace the branch+PR model with declared units of work that have
//! explicit scope, agent attribution, priority, and hierarchical decomposition.
//! Multiple intents can be active simultaneously on the same working tree
//! because they declare non-overlapping scopes.

/// Check whether two scope patterns overlap.
/// Patterns use simple prefix/glob matching: `src/auth/**` overlaps with `src/auth/jwt.rs`.
fn scopes_overlap(a: &[String], b: &[String]) -> Vec<String> {
    let mut overlaps = Vec::new();
    for pa in a {
        let pa_base = pa.trim_end_matches("/**").trim_end_matches("/*");
        for pb in b {
            let pb_base = pb.trim_end_matches("/**").trim_end_matches("/*");
            // Overlap if one is a prefix of the other, or they are the same
            if pa_base.starts_with(pb_base) || pb_base.starts_with(pa_base) || pa == pb {
                overlaps.push(format!("{} <-> {}", pa, pb));
            }
        }
    }
    overlaps
}
